FC Tokyo on Wednesday announced that their forward Nathan Burns has been called up for Australia’s upcoming 2018 World Cup qualifier.
The reigning Asian Cup champions will face Jordan away on October 8, in what will be their only fixture of the next international break.
“I’m always happy to have been chosen for the national team and it’s an incredible honour,” Burns said in a club statement.
“Jordan will be a tough match so I want to play hard.”
Burns has been rewarded for his form since joining Tokyo in July, the 10-time Australia international contributing two goals in eight MEIJI YASUDA J1 League appearances.
